The Essence of an Orangery
An [Orangery Installation Professionals](https://mathiassen-andresen-2.mdwrite.net/5-laws-everyone-working-in-established-orangery-installers-should-be-aware-of) is typically mistaken for a conservatory, however there are distinctive features that set them apart. Generally identified by a solid roofing and deep brick walls, orangeries are created to be more integrated with the primary house. They typically serve multi-functional functions - from a dining-room or lounge to a relaxing garden retreat.

Q1: How much does it cost to construct an orangery?
A: The cost varies based on size, products, and area. Normally, budget plans vary from ₤ 20,000 to ₤ 100,000 or more. Consulting with design professionals can offer a more precise price quote.
Q2: Do I need planning consent for an orangery?
A: It depends upon regional guidelines and the size of the orangery. Generally, smaller structures might not need authorization, but it's best to check with local authorities.
Q3: What is the finest orientation for an orangery?
A: Ideally, an orangery needs to face south or west to maximize sunlight direct exposure throughout the day.
Q4: Can an orangery be used year-round?
